SOUTHERN PRALINE SAUCE



Southern Praline Sauce image

Southern Praline Sauce, with toasted buttered pecans in a thick, decadent sweet syrup, is an easy and delicious dessert topping for ice cream or pound cake!

Provided by JB @ The Grateful Girl Cooks!

Categories     Dessert     Sauce

Time 25m

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 1/4 cups chopped pecans
7 Tablespoons butter ((divided))
1 1/2 cups brown sugar ((I used dark brown sugar))
3 Tablespoons flour
3/4 cup light corn syrup
2/3 cup evaporated milk

Steps:

  • Place chopped pecans and 3 Tablespoons butter in a saucepan or skillet. Cook over medium heat 5-6 minutes, stirring occasionally, till toasted nicely. Be sure and keep an eye on the pecans so they don't burn.
  • In another large saucepan or skillet, melt the remaining butter.
  • Whisk in the brown sugar, flour and corn syrup until they are well blended. Cook on medium-high for 4-5 minutes stirring often, until the sugar is completely dissolved.
  • Pour in the evaporated milk and add the pecan mixture. Stir till completely blended. Remove from heat.
  • Let sauce cool slightly, then pour it into clean jars or containers (Mason jars work great!)
  • This sauce needs to be kept refrigerated. It should last approximately 3 weeks in the refrigerator once you open it and a bit longer unopened. When you are ready to serve it, heat jar on low temperature approximately 15-20 seconds (microwave temps. vary) in microwave, or until pourable.
  • Be sure if you give this as a gift (the jars would look great with a pretty ribbon and tag), to include instructions as to keeping it refrigerated, and to reheat slightly in microwave when ready to serve. Enjoy!

SOUTHERN PRALINES



Southern Pralines image

This recipe is truly Southern, and it's been a family favorite for years. I've packed many a Christmas tin with this candy.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 35m

Yield about 3-1/2 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 7

3 cups packed brown sugar
1 cup heavy whipping cream
2 tablespoons light corn syrup
1/4 teaspoon salt
1-1/2 cups chopped pecans
1/4 cup butter, cubed
1-1/4 teaspoons vanilla extract

Steps:

  • In a large heavy saucepan, combine the brown sugar, cream, corn syrup and salt. Bring to a boil over medium heat, stirring constantly. Cook until a candy thermometer reads 230° (thread stage), stirring occasionally., Carefully stir in pecans and butter. Cook, stirring occasionally, until a candy thermometer reads 236° (soft-ball stage)., Remove from the heat; stir in vanilla. Beat with a wooden spoon until candy thickens and begins to lose its gloss, about 4-5 minutes. , Quickly drop by heaping tablespoonfuls onto waxed paper; spread to form 2-in. patties. Let stand until set. Store in an airtight container.

SOUTHERN PRALINE SWEET POTATO CASSEROLE



Southern Praline Sweet Potato Casserole image

Make and share this Southern Praline Sweet Potato Casserole recipe from Food.com.

Provided by PalatablePastime

Categories     Yam/Sweet Potato

Time 2h10m

Yield 8-10 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

6 large sweet potatoes (about 5 1/2 pounds)
3/4 cup milk
1/2 cup unsalted butter
3 eggs, lightly beaten
3/4 cup dark brown sugar, packed
4 tablespoons unsalted butter
3/4 cup dark brown sugar, packed
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on grated nutmeg
3/4 cup heavy cream
1 1/2 cups coarsely chopped pecans
2 teaspoons vanilla

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
  • Pierce potatoes several times with a fork or icepick and place on a baking pan; bake in preheated oven 1 1/4-1 1/2 hours or until potatoes are tender; set aside until cool.
  • In a small pan, heat milk and butter until hot but not boiling; keep warm.
  • Cut the potatoes in half and scoop out the insides into a mixing bowl and discard the skins.
  • Mash the potatoes with whatever method you prefer (masher, ricer, food mill, etc).
  • Stir milk into potatoes; add eggs and continue to blend until well combined; stir in brown sugar.
  • Butter a 9 X 13 inch casserole or baking dish and spread mixture into pan; set aside while making topping.
  • Melt the butter in a large saucepan over low heat; stir in the brown sugar, salt, cinnamon, nutmeg, cream.
  • and pecans.
  • Heat to a simmer and cook, stirring constantly, until mixture is thick, 5-7 minutes (if mixture starts to boil, reduce heat slightly to maintain a simmer).
  • Remove from heat and stir in vanilla.
  • Pour topping over potatoes in dish, spreading with spatula.
  • Bake in preheated oven for 30 minutes, or until slightly crusty and set.
  • Serve immediately.
